Phase Field Model of Hydraulic Fracturing in Poroelastic Media: Fracture Propagation, Arrest, and Branching Under Fluid Injection and Extraction
The simulation of fluid-driven fracture propagation in a porous medium is a major computational challenge, with applications in geosciences and engineering.
